Comprehensive Engineering Specifications

Technical Attribute Standard Value
Complete Model Reference Bently Nevada 3500/60-01-02 163179-01+133819-01
Monitor Module 163179-01
I/O Module 133819-01
Input Channels 6 independent temperature measurement inputs
Sensor Compatibility RTD (2-wire, 3-wire, 4-wire); Thermocouple Types J, K, E, T
RTD Element Types Pt100, Pt1000, Ni120, Cu10
RTD Measurement Range -200°C to +850°C
Thermocouple Range -200°C to +1370°C (type-dependent)
Measurement Accuracy (RTD) ±0.5°C
Measurement Accuracy (TC) ±1.0°C
Display Resolution 0.1°C
Channel Scan Rate 1 second per channel
Alarm Architecture Dual-level Alert/Danger, programmable per channel
Analog Output 4-20mA isolated recorder outputs per channel
Communication Protocol Proprietary 3500 rack protocol; Modbus TCP/IP gateway
Power Consumption 7.5W typical via 3500 rack backplane
Operating Temperature -30°C to +65°C ambient
Humidity Rating 5-95% RH, non-condensing
Hazardous Area Rating Class I Division 2 (with approved barriers)
Regulatory Compliance ISO 9001:2015, API 670, CE, UL 508, CSA C22.2

Expert Technical FAQ

Q1: What installation compliance requirements apply to the 3500/60-01-02 163179-01+133819-01 in hazardous area environments?
A: The module is rated for Class I Division 2 hazardous locations when installed with approved intrinsic safety barriers. Installation must conform to NEC Article 501 (North America) or IEC 60079 (international) requirements. All wiring must use appropriately rated cable glands and conduit seals. Commissioning documentation should reference the module’s UL 508 and CSA C22.2 certifications for authority having jurisdiction (AHJ) approval submissions.

Q2: How does the module maintain measurement accuracy across extreme ambient temperature variations?
A: The 163179-01 monitor incorporates internal cold junction compensation for thermocouple inputs and supports 3-wire/4-wire RTD configurations that eliminate lead resistance errors from extended cable runs. The module’s -30°C to +65°C operating range is validated through environmental stress screening during manufacturing, ensuring Compliance Standards are maintained across arctic upstream installations and high-ambient tropical facilities alike.

Q3: What firmware version compatibility considerations apply when integrating this module into an existing 3500 rack?
A: The 3500/60-01-02 163179-01+133819-01 is compatible with 3500 Rack Configuration Software versions supporting the 3500/60 module family. Firmware version verification should be performed during commissioning using the rack’s system software. Bently Nevada’s Original Documentation includes firmware compatibility matrices; consult the supplied technical manual or contact our application engineering team to confirm compatibility with your specific rack firmware revision before installation.

Q6: Can the 163179-01 monitor module be replaced independently without replacing the 133819-01 I/O module?
A: Yes. The modular architecture of the 3500/60 assembly supports independent replacement of the monitor module (163179-01) and the I/O module (133819-01). The I/O module’s hot-swappable design allows field replacement without disconnecting field wiring, minimizing system downtime during maintenance. However, both modules should be reconfigured and verified together following any replacement to ensure alarm setpoints, sensor type assignments, and recorder output calibrations remain synchronized with the system’s safety logic.
